S E N I O R S CLASS OFFICERS David Dexter ...,,., .............. P resident john Christie ......., ......... V ice-President Richard Sirois ,..,,.. ..,.4...... S ecretary Durward Emery ...,.4. .A...., T reasurer CLASS ADVISORS Arlene Adams Maurice Earle CLASS POEM Swiftly flies the time when all's content And finds us four years older than four years ago When first we stepped inside your doors Seeking knowledge-knowing not, but wanting to know Swiftly passed the time and now we find L As we, like those before us, leave your sheltering halls, That things we love aren't easily left behind- Like happy moments spent 'neath your majestic walls. But swiftly moves the time-we cannot linger. To us is thrust wet clay of future generations To mold as best we can. We must not fail Peace must be shaped for us and all the nations. Now time has gone, and so with it our schooldays, Although we're sad our heads are still held high- And with God's help we face mankind determined To bring you glory, make you proud - Dear M. C. I. Ruth Shaw 14
